CREATE.INDEX FILE STATE NO.NULLS CREATE.INDEX FILE ZIP NO.NULLS
And when no one needs to update the file BUILD.INDEX FILE STATE and from another terminal BUILD.INDEX FILE ZIP
or from just one terminal BUILD.INDEX FILE ALL Which will generate a phantom for the other indexes.
Updating may resume when all of the indexes have finished generating.
